What Is a Flatwork Ironer Belt?
A flatwork ironer belt is a specialized industrial belt used inside a flatwork ironing machine to guide and transport textiles through the ironing process.
Unlike ordinary conveyor belts, an ironer belt operates in an environment where heat, continuous movement, pressure, moisture, and mechanical tension can occur simultaneously.
Depending on the machine design, the belt may be used to:
-
Transport laundry through the heated ironing section
-
Guide sheets and other flat textiles
-
Maintain stable fabric movement
-
Help control the position of textiles during ironing
-
Transfer textiles between different machine sections
-
Support continuous high-volume laundry production
Flatwork ironer belts are therefore an important part of the overall ironing system. A belt that is not properly matched to the machine can cause tracking problems, premature wear, fabric marking, belt deformation, or unnecessary production downtime.
Why Is the Ironer Belt So Important?
The ironing process requires more than heat alone.
For a textile to pass smoothly through an industrial ironer, the fabric must move at a controlled and consistent speed while remaining properly positioned against the ironing surface.
The belt plays a direct role in this process.
A high-quality flatwork ironer belt can help provide:
Stable fabric transportation
The belt helps move textiles continuously through the machine without unnecessary slipping or lateral movement.
Consistent running performance
Dimensional stability is important because excessive stretching or shrinkage can affect belt tracking and machine operation.
Heat resistance
The belt must be selected according to the temperature and heating method of the ironer.
Longer service life
Suitable materials and construction can reduce premature belt degradation in demanding laundry environments.
Reduced maintenance interruptions
A properly selected belt can contribute to more stable operation and reduce the frequency of belt replacement.

How to Choose the Right Flatwork Ironer Belt
Selecting the correct belt begins with understanding the machine rather than simply searching for the cheapest replacement.
Here are six important factors to check.
1. Machine Type
First identify the exact type of equipment.
For example:
-
Flatwork ironer
-
Industrial laundry ironer
-
Sheet ironer
-
Commercial laundry finishing machine
-
Ironer and folding line
-
Textile finishing equipment
Different machines may use different belt structures.
2. Belt Position
Determine where the belt is installed.
A belt operating directly in or near a heated section may require substantially different material characteristics from a belt used in a cooler conveying section.
This is one reason why the terms ironer belt, guide tape, and laundry conveyor belt should not automatically be treated as interchangeable.
3. Operating Temperature
Temperature is one of the most important factors in belt selection.
The actual operating temperature, heating method, exposure time, and distance from the heat source should be considered.
For high-temperature environments, aramid/Nomex constructions may be appropriate. For less demanding areas, polyester constructions may provide a more economical solution.

Flatwork Ironer Belt vs. Ordinary Conveyor Belt
A common mistake is assuming that an ordinary conveyor belt can replace an ironer belt.
The two products may look similar, but their operating environments can be very different.
A conventional conveyor belt may be designed primarily for material transportation at normal temperatures.
A flatwork ironer belt, however, may need to handle:
-
Continuous heat exposure
-
Mechanical tension
-
Repeated bending
-
Moisture
-
High-speed movement
-
Textile contact
-
Long operating cycles
Therefore, heat resistance and dimensional stability are key considerations when selecting an ironer belt.
For high-temperature laundry applications, specialized materials such as aramid or Nomex can provide characteristics that ordinary conveyor belt materials may not offer.
What Causes Flatwork Ironer Belt Failure?
Understanding common failure causes can help laundry operators extend belt service life.
Excessive Heat
Using a belt outside its suitable temperature range can accelerate material degradation.
Incorrect Tension
Too much tension can place unnecessary stress on the belt and machine components. Too little tension can lead to slipping, tracking problems, or unstable transportation.
Incorrect Belt Size
A belt that is too wide, too narrow, too thick, or too thin may not run correctly in the original machine structure.
Misalignment
Improper roller alignment or tracking conditions can cause uneven belt wear.
Incompatible Material
A polyester belt, elastic belt, and aramid belt do not have identical performance characteristics. The material must match the application.
Poor Installation
Even a high-quality belt can experience premature failure if it is incorrectly installed, joined, tensioned, or aligned.
How to Extend the Service Life of an Ironer Belt
Replacing a belt is only one part of maintenance. Correct operating practices can also make a significant difference.
Keep the Belt Properly Tensioned
Follow the equipment manufacturer's recommended tension procedure. Avoid excessive tension simply to compensate for tracking problems.
Check Belt Tracking Regularly
If the belt repeatedly moves toward one side, investigate the cause instead of continuously adjusting the belt.
Possible causes include roller alignment, tension imbalance, worn components, or incorrect installation.
Monitor Operating Temperature
Make sure the belt material is appropriate for the actual temperature of the machine.
Inspect for Surface Damage
Regularly check for:
-
Cracks
-
Fraying
-
Surface wear
-
Edge damage
-
Stretching
-
Discoloration
-
Localized deformation
Early detection can prevent an unexpected production stoppage.
Replace Belts Before Complete Failure
For a commercial laundry, waiting until an ironer belt breaks completely can result in unnecessary downtime.
Planned replacement based on wear condition and operating hours can be more efficient than emergency replacement.
